  • Page 3: Introduction

    Introduction This kit allows to interconnect Studer 900 preamp and equalizer module to put them in a Rack. The kit allows to connect inputs, outputs and power supply necessary for the use of the set. Optional accessories Labo ★ K Effects Studer 900 PSU Kit...

  • Page 5: Assembly Instructions

    Assembly instructions 1) Solder components on the PCB. 2) Prepare interconnection ribbons 3) Prepare the audio wires 4) Fix the in / Out card 5) Connect the cards to connectors p4 et p6. 6) Connect PSU BUS to a regulated power supply +48v, 0V, +15V/-15V -25V et -6V.
  • Page 6: Studer 900 P6 Interface Board Part List

    900 p6 interface board part list Connector X2 Molex 22-27-2101-10 Connector 1 Din 41612 R1, R2 6K81 470R 47µF/63v All resistors are 1/4w metal film 1% It is intended to wire an Insert between the channel (pre-EQ) and the output stage.

  • Page 9 Component layout The places on the card not used for this kit are hidden. Place straps (component tails) where they are marked with yellow lines. It is possible to wire an output potentiometer (not supplied) In this case, do not implant the strap surrounded by a red circle. Wiring the optional 10K linear potentiometer with a shielded wire (GND shown in black) It is planned to be able to install a 3-pin Molex connector.
